BR1986FB;1426689 wrote:Graham is ok. Nothing great but it could be worse. We were spoiled with Awesome Dawson being pretty much money from 50+. Same can't be said about Graham.
That's what I thought as well BR, but then I saw this on OBR:

"Here's a couple of interesting stats on Graham to size him up to the beloved Dawson...

Graham made nine field goals of 50 yards or longer last season for the Houston Texans. Dawson's best year was eight in 2011.

Graham's career kick % is actually slightly higher than Dawson's at 85.4 as opposed to 84 -- although, it should be noted Graham has attempted 76 less field goals (in two less professional seasons).

I find this very interesting, because they're actually similar kickers. Graham has kicked in the state spending seven seasons with the Bengals and made a short stop at New England to show he can kick in adverse weather. "
